En Java, l'abstraction de données est définie comme le processus de réduction de l'objet à son essence afin que seules les caractéristiques nécessaires soient exposées aux utilisateurs L'abstraction définit un objet en termes de ses propriétés (attributs), son comportement (méthodes) et ses interfaces (moyens de communication avec d'autres objets).
Qu'entend-on par abstraction en Java ?
En Java, l'abstraction de données est définie comme le processus de réduction de l'objet à son essence afin que seules les caractéristiques nécessaires soient exposées aux utilisateurs. L'abstraction définit un objet en termes de propriétés (attributs), de comportement (méthodes) et d'interfaces (moyens de communication avec d'autres objets).
Qu'est-ce que l'abstraction avec exemple ?
En termes simples, l'abstraction " affiche" uniquement les attributs pertinents des objets et "masque" les détails inutiles. Par exemple, lorsque nous conduisons une voiture, nous ne nous préoccupons que de conduire la voiture comme démarrer/arrêter la voiture, accélérer/arrêter, etc.
Qu'est-ce que l'abstraction en Java, donnez un exemple ?
Data Abstraction est la propriété en vertu de laquelle seuls les détails essentiels sont affichés à l'utilisateur. Les unités triviales ou non essentielles ne sont pas affichées à l'utilisateur. Ex: Une voiture est considérée comme une voiture plutôt que comme ses composants individuels.
Pourquoi utilisons-nous l'abstraction en Java ?
Le but principal de l'abstraction est de cacher les détails inutiles aux utilisateurs. L'abstraction sélectionne des données à partir d'un plus grand pool pour ne montrer que les détails pertinents de l'objet à l'utilisateur. Cela aide à réduire la complexité et les efforts de programmation.